原文:JDFS:一款分布式文件管理实用程序第一篇(线程池、epoll、上传、下载)

一 前言 截止目前,笔者在博客园上面已经发表了 篇关于网络下载的文章,这三篇博客实现了基于socket的http多线程远程断点下载实用程序。笔者打算在此基础上开发出一款分布式文件管理实用程序,截止目前,已经实现了 服务端 客户端 的上传 下载部分的功能逻辑。涉及到的知识点包括线程池技术 linux epoll并发技术 上传 下载等。JDFS的下载功能的逻辑部分与笔者前几篇关于JWebFileTra ...

2017-05-19 23:46 0 1646 推荐指数:

查看详情

JDFS:一款分布式文件管理系统,第五(整体架构描述)

一 前言   截止到目前为止,虽然并不完美,但是JDFS已经初步具备了完整的分布式文件管理功能了,包括:文件的冗余存储、文件元信息的查询、文件下载文件的删除等。本文将对JDFS做一个总体的介绍,主要是介绍JDFS的整体架构,流程图等,另外还会介绍如何安装部署运行JDFS.当然正如前面几篇博客 ...

Sun Oct 08 03:25:00 CST 2017 1 1644
JDFS:一款分布式文件管理系统,第三(流式云存储)

一 前言   看了一下,距离上一篇博客的发表已经过去了4个月,时间过得好快啊。本篇博客是JDFS系列的第三博客,JDFS的目的是为了实现一个分布式文件管理系统,前两实现了基本的上传下载功能,但是那还不能算作分布式文件管理。本篇博客将在前两的基础上增加一系列分布式的功能,比如流式云存储 ...

Tue Sep 26 06:59:00 CST 2017 6 834
CentOS7搭建FastDFS V5.11分布式文件系统-第一篇

1.绪论 最近要用到fastDFS,所以自己研究了一下,在搭建FastDFS的过程中遇到过很多的问题,为了能帮忙到以后搭建FastDFS的同学,少走弯路,与大家分享一下。FastDFS的作者淘宝资深架构余庆,这个优秀的轻量及的分布式文件系统的开源没多久,立马就火了。由于篇幅较大,本博文共四 ...

Thu Nov 09 05:08:00 CST 2017 0 1668
基于zipkin分布式链路追踪系统预研第一篇

 本文为博主原创文章,未经博主允许不得转载。    分布式服务追踪系统起源于Google的论文“Dapper, a Large-Scale Distributed Systems Tracing Infrastructure”(译文可参考此处),Twitter的zipkin是基于此论文上线较早 ...

Tue May 31 06:33:00 CST 2016 1 2764
java 线程第一篇 之 ThreadPoolExcutor

一:什么是线程?   java 线程是将大量的线程集中管理的类,包括对线程的创建,资源的管理线程生命周期的管理。当系统中存在大量的异步任务的时候就考虑使用java线程管理所有的线程。减少系统资源的开销。 二:线程工厂类有多少种?   java1.8 的官方文档提供了三种线程工厂类 ...

Thu Aug 02 05:48:00 CST 2018 0 5176
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M